WNS Updates Progress on Acquisition by Capgemini (Business Wire)
|
|
NEW YORK & LONDON & MUMBAI, India--(BUSINESS WIRE)--$WNS #Acquisition--WNS (Holdings) Limited (NYSE: WNS) (“WNS”), a digital-led business transformation and services company, is pleased to report that as of September 11, 2025, both WNS and Capgemini S.E. (EURONEXT PARIS: CAP) (“Capgemini”) have obtained all antitrust and regulatory consents, approvals or clearances, as applicable, required to be obtained in connection with the previously announced acquisition of WNS by Capgemini through a scheme of arrangement (the “Scheme”) under the Companies (Jersey) Law 1991 (the “Transaction”). The satisfaction of this condition precedent is in addition to the Scheme approval by WNS shareholders which was disclosed in our press release and form 8-K on August 29, 2025.

Whoz Appoints Tech Leaders Gilles Rigal and José Duarte to Board of Directors to Accelerate Global Growth (Business Wire)
|
|
PARIS--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Whoz, the French SaaS leader in staffing optimization, today announced the appointment of Gilles Rigal as Chairman of the Board and José Duarte as Board Member, reinforcing its governance and international growth strategy.
These appointments come as Whoz accelerates its expansion across Europe and the United States. With more than 800,000 users in 115 countries, Whoz has become the go-to staffing platform for consulting, engineering, and IT service leaders including Capgemini, Atos, Devoteam, and Akkodis.
Renowned Tech Experts to Guide Expansion
Gilles Rigal brings more than 20 years of investment and strategic experience in software and digital services. As former Managing Partner at Seven2 (formerly Apax Partners), he supported companies such as Infovista, Altran, Inetum, and BIP. A seasoned entrepreneur and investor in SaaS startups, he will leverage his expertise to drive Whoz's international development.

ServiceNow Customer Excellence Leader Joins xtype Board to Accelerate Platform Success at Scale (Business Wire)
|
|
Simon Short's appointment reflects market demand for embedded governance to accelerate customer success.COVINA,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--xtype today announced that Simon Short, senior vice president of customer excellence at ServiceNow, has joined its Board of Directors. Short has extensive industry experience across both software and customer success, including as former EVP of customer success at Salesforce, former CTO at Capgemini, and global lead for Capgemini's Digital Customer Experience (DCX) Global Service Line. At ServiceNow, Short leads the Customer Excellence Group, ensuring ServiceNow customers achieve exceptional outcomes from their platform investments.
Short's appointment to xtype's board underscores his confidence in the company's trajectory. xtype has a strong partnership with ServiceNow including a 2024 investment from ServiceNow Ventures and its designation as a ServiceNow Advanced Platform Build Partner. WNS Shareholders Overwhelmingly Approve Acquisition by Capgemini (Business Wire)
|
|
NEW YORK & LONDON & MUMBAI, India--(BUSINESS WIRE)--$WNS #Acquisition--WNS (Holdings) Limited (NYSE: WNS) (“WNS”), a digital-led business transformation and services company, today announced that its shareholders overwhelmingly voted to approve the acquisition by Capgemini SE (EUR: CAP) (“Capgemini”) at a special court-ordered meeting of the shareholders (“Court Meeting”) and General Meeting of Shareholders (“General Meeting”), each held on August 29, 2025. Approximately 99.9% of the shares voted were cast in favor of the transaction, representing approximately 79.2% of WNS' total outstanding shares as of the voting record date.
On July 7, 2025, WNS and Capgemini announced they had entered into a definitive transaction agreement pursuant to which Capgemini will acquire WNS for a cash consideration of $76.50 per WNS share.
